S9 1AL is a safe, established residential area on Sandstone Avenue, 0.5km from Wincobank in Sheffield. Administratively it sits within Shiregreen and Brightside ward and the Sheffield, Brightside and Hillsborough constituency.

This is a strong family neighbourhood — a culturally diverse area with a strong community identity. This is a stable, socially diverse area (average age 41) — accessible for a wide range of households, from young families to empty nesters. 85%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 31 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: With prices averaging £130k, this is one of the more affordable postcodes in the area.

Census 2021 statistics for S9 1AL are sourced from Output Area E00039751 (shared with 3 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
